Natal will sell ‘millions’ says Greenberg

Posted By | On 06th, Apr. 2010

Microsoft product director Aaron Greenberg has predicted that MS’s upcoming new peripheral for the Xbox 360 will sell ‘millions and millions’ this holiday season.

This claim will likely excite many 3rd party developers, almost 3/4’s of which are creating software for the device.

Sega West boss Mike Hayes has said that he hopes Natal will hit half of Microsoft’s European installed base.

“Our focus for launch [for Natal] is on original experiences, built from the ground up,” Greenberg told Edge’s April issue. “We believe that’s important because the first impression has to be a magical one.

“But because we expect millions and millions of these things to be sold this Holiday, over time developers will know millions of customers have these sensors so they can add functionality to their games.

“So you may see hybrid approaches, but our initial focus is on those unique experiences.”

We can only speculate as to what we expect from Natal, but we can say, is that it is going to make a big splash when it releases later this year.
